See the GNU - * General Public License for more details. - * - * You should have received a copy of the GNU General Public License - * along with this program; if not, write to the Free Software - * Foundation, Inc., 51 Franklin St, Fifth Floor, Boston, MA - * 02110-1301 USA - * - */ - -#ifndef __EVENT_H__ -#define __EVENT_H__ - -/* - * Mbox events - * - * The event mechanism is based on a pair of event buffers (buffers A and - * B) at fixed locations in the target's memory. The host processes one - * buffer while the other buffer continues to collect events. If the host - * is not processing events, an interrupt is issued to signal that a buffer - * is ready. Once the host is done with processing events from one buffer, - * it signals the target (with an ACK interrupt) that the event buffer is - * free. - */ - -enum { - RSSI_SNR_TRIGGER_0_EVENT_ID = BIT(0), - RSSI_SNR_TRIGGER_1_EVENT_ID = BIT(1), - RSSI_SNR_TRIGGER_2_EVENT_ID = BIT(2), - RSSI_SNR_TRIGGER_3_EVENT_ID = BIT(3), - RSSI_SNR_TRIGGER_4_EVENT_ID = BIT(4), - RSSI_SNR_TRIGGER_5_EVENT_ID = BIT(5), - RSSI_SNR_TRIGGER_6_EVENT_ID = BIT(6), - RSSI_SNR_TRIGGER_7_EVENT_ID = BIT(7), - MEASUREMENT_START_EVENT_ID = BIT(8), - MEASUREMENT_COMPLETE_EVENT_ID = BIT(9), - SCAN_COMPLETE_EVENT_ID = BIT(10), - SCHEDULED_SCAN_COMPLETE_EVENT_ID = BIT(11), - AP_DISCOVERY_COMPLETE_EVENT_ID = BIT(12), - PS_REPORT_EVENT_ID = BIT(13), - PSPOLL_DELIVERY_FAILURE_EVENT_ID = BIT(14), - DISCONNECT_EVENT_COMPLETE_ID = BIT(15), - JOIN_EVENT_COMPLETE_ID = BIT(16), - CHANNEL_SWITCH_COMPLETE_EVENT_ID = BIT(17), - BSS_LOSE_EVENT_ID = BIT(18), - REGAINED_BSS_EVENT_ID = BIT(19), - ROAMING_TRIGGER_MAX_TX_RETRY_EVENT_ID = BIT(20), - SOFT_GEMINI_SENSE_EVENT_ID = BIT(22), - SOFT_GEMINI_PREDICTION_EVENT_ID = BIT(23), - SOFT_GEMINI_AVALANCHE_EVENT_ID = BIT(24), - PLT_RX_CALIBRATION_COMPLETE_EVENT_ID = BIT(25), - DBG_EVENT_ID = BIT(26), - HEALTH_CHECK_REPLY_EVENT_ID = BIT(27), - PERIODIC_SCAN_COMPLETE_EVENT_ID = BIT(28), - PERIODIC_SCAN_REPORT_EVENT_ID = BIT(29), - BA_SESSION_TEAR_DOWN_EVENT_ID = BIT(30), - EVENT_MBOX_ALL_EVENT_ID = 0x7fffffff, -}; - -enum { - EVENT_ENTER_POWER_SAVE_FAIL = 0, - EVENT_ENTER_POWER_SAVE_SUCCESS, - EVENT_EXIT_POWER_SAVE_FAIL, - EVENT_EXIT_POWER_SAVE_SUCCESS, -}; - -struct event_debug_report { - u8 debug_event_id; - u8 num_params; - __le16 pad; - __le32 report_1; - __le32 report_2; - __le32 report_3; -} __packed; - -#define NUM_OF_RSSI_SNR_TRIGGERS 8 - -struct event_mailbox { - __le32 events_vector; - __le32 events_mask; - __le32 reserved_1; - __le32 reserved_2; - - u8 dbg_event_id; - u8 num_relevant_params; - __le16 reserved_3; - __le32 event_report_p1; - __le32 event_report_p2; - __le32 event_report_p3; - - u8 number_of_scan_results; - u8 scan_tag; - u8 reserved_4[2]; - __le32 compl_scheduled_scan_status; - - __le16 scheduled_scan_attended_channels; - u8 soft_gemini_sense_info; - u8 soft_gemini_protective_info; - s8 rssi_snr_trigger_metric[NUM_OF_RSSI_SNR_TRIGGERS]; - u8 channel_switch_status; - u8 scheduled_scan_status; - u8 ps_status; - - u8 reserved_5[29]; -} __packed; - -int wl1271_event_unmask(struct wl1271 *wl); -void wl1271_event_mbox_config(struct wl1271 *wl); -int wl1271_event_handle(struct wl1271 *wl, u8 mbox); -void wl1271_pspoll_work(struct work_struct *work); - -#endif |
